In 2020-2021, 1,130 people earned their degree in agricultural teacher education, making the major the 400th most popular in the United States.
Across Washington, there were 7 agricultural teacher education gra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 7 agricultural teacher education graduates with average earnings and debt of $40,905 and $22,558 respectively.
That schools that top this list have a program in agricultural teacher education in which the largest percentage of students at the school are enrolled.
